Amida is currently looking for a Bid and Proposal Manager.

The Bid and Proposal Manager is a key and strategic role within Amida's Business Development department. The successful candidate will lead and manage the development of high-quality, compliant, and compelling proposal responses for a range of data-centric clients across the federal and state sectors.

What you will do:

Familiarize him or herself with the Company's proposal process and work with the

Company Capture Manager to make any necessary tailoring with respect to the size and

scope of the opportunity

Identify and evaluate federal and state procurements and lead proposal response efforts for new and recompete opportunities

Unpack and deliver a proposal response plan and outline to include all required response sections

Ensure proposal compliance with all RFP requirements in all proposal sections

Lead the preparation and delivery of all proposal sections, plans, and specifications

Integrate the efforts of planning/engineering staff with proposal staff, and proposal staff with production staff

Prepare, maintain, and manage the master proposal schedule

Plan the proposal and proposal-support activities

Issue a writer's package to the proposal team, and manage content development in

adherence to the master proposal schedule

Lead the development of a proposal outline, storyboards (if required), and content,

working through the Volume Leads

Orchestrate and support proposal reviews

Ensure approval of all corporate commitment statements

Coordinate the approval of any exceptions or deviations

Prepare status reports and briefings for higher-level management

Once the proposal is submitted, the Proposal Manager shall support the following activities as requested

New, updated proposal submissions - to include post-submission amendments

Oral preparation, briefing slides, presentation reviews, and feedback

Documentation of all proposal lessons learned

Proposal schedules and status reports

Management of the entire proposal life-cycle

Development of technical and non-technical proposal response content

Draft proposal versions

Final proposal document

Required Skills:

Prior experience in the development, management, and leadership of complex federal and

state Information Technology (IT) contract proposals

Ability to independently lead proposal development efforts and provide daily Leadership

updates

Proven ability to simultaneously lead multiple highly differentiated proposal responses

with separate support stakeholders

Experience efficiently identifying, evaluating, and presenting programs to Leadership

teams

Prior experience utilizing procurement sites, including SAM.gov, GovWin, and GSA eBuy

Prior experience establishing and leading meetings with federal and state procurement

officers

Experience in State Medicaid and CMS Final Rule market analysis and procurement

response

Experience developing, validating, and delivering compliant documents based on federal and state procurement requirements

Experience and comfortability in the proactive research and continuous evaluation of

federal and state programs

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written

Excellent organizational, time management, prioritization, communication, and decision-making skills; exquisite attention to detail

Solid experience forming teams, facilitating meetings, leading solution sessions, and

providing constructive feedback to stakeholders

Ability and understanding to derive and develop original technical and non-technical

content in collaboration with SMEs

Aptitude and interest in obtaining an in-depth knowledge of Amida solutions and value

proposition

Familiarity with Federal Acquisition Regulations (FAR) and standard Federal or State

Government procurement requirements

Solid analytical and problem-solving skills and the ability to work effectively in a team

setting

Experience developing project timelines and managing various stakeholders to complete

tasks and milestones on time and within budget estimates

Experience in (and comfort with) business partner communications and management of external teaming partner stakeholders

Expertise with proposal tools such as SharePoint, Microsoft Office suite, Air Table, and

Salesforce

Experience with Program/Project Management principles and concepts (WBS, PWS, SOW, SOO, RACI, Risk Management)

Formal proposal training and relevant certifications (e.g., APMP, Shipley, etc.)

Bachelor's degree

A minimum of five years of experience managing proposals submitted to federal or state

agencies

Track record of federal or state IT services proposal development and contract wins

Thorough understanding of the standard government proposal process

Commitment to quality

Strong written and verbal communication and collaboration skills

Ability to lead a small proposal team
